Ctenopyge was named by Linnarsson (1880) [Sepkoski's age data: Cm Fran-u Sepkoski's reference number: 81]. It is not extant.
It was assigned to Ptychopariida by Sepkoski (2002); and to Olenidae by Jell and Adrain (2002).

Age range: base of the Maentwrogian to the top of the Niuchehean or 497.00000 to 486.85000 Ma
